Door software ingeschakelde Flash™ |
Een open source-technologie

Het Linux Foundation-logo
Door software ingeschakeld Flash-logo

KIOXIAheeft in samenwerking met de Er wordt een nieuw venster geopend.Linux Foundation een nieuw open source project opgericht, het Software-Enabled Flash projectEr wordt een nieuw venster geopend.. De missie van dit project is het ontwikkelen van open source Software-Enabled Flash technologie API's, applicaties en bibliotheken ter ondersteuning van flashopslagapparaten in hyperscale datacenters. KIOXIA, de uitvinder van Software-Enabled Flash, creëerde dit project als een speciale plek voor open samenwerking tussen flashleveranciers, controllerontwikkelaars, schijffabrikanten en opslagontwikkelaars. Meer informatie vindt u in het Software-Enabled Flash projectEr wordt een nieuw venster geopend..

Nieuwe documenten en video's

Software-Enabled Flash™-technologie

Hyperscalers willen zich ontwikkelen en het gebruik van flashgeheugen in hun datacenters herdefiniëren. Om deze trend te versnellen, zijn tools nodig die de native snelheid en flexibiliteit van flashgeheugen benutten, in combinatie met het gemak van softwaregedefinieerde opslag.

Software-Enabled Flash™ (SEF) technologie ondersteunt dit opkomende paradigma door de relatie tussen de host en solid-state opslag fundamenteel te herdefiniëren. Software-Enabled Flash-technologie bestaat uit speciaal gebouwde, mediacentrische flashhardware gericht op hyperscaler-vereisten, met een open source API en bibliotheken om de functionaliteit te bieden die hyperscalers vereisen.

Kortom: Software-Enabled Flash-technologie biedt softwareflexibiliteit en schaalbaarheid voor flashgeheugen.

Overhead van traditionele industriële oplossingen

  • Door firmware geïnduceerde ‘long tail latency’
  • DRAM-buffers
  • Device-level RAID
  • Overvoorziening beperkende capaciteit
  • Stroombeveiliging op apparaatniveau

Uitdagingen van de huidige HDD-gestuurde aanpak

  • Legacy van HDD-paradigma's voor opslag
  • Vaste functionaliteit volgens de normen
  • IO blender approach voor blokkeren en slijtagenivellering creëert werklastconflicten van huurders
  • Beperkt het flash geheugen om aan de gebruikte normen te voldoen

Door software ingeschakelde Flash-technologie

  • Stelt de host in staat om latentie-optimalisaties te beheren
  • Biedt DRAM, no-DRAM en hybride oplossingen
  • RAID wordt een beslissing voor hostcontrole
  • Geeft toegang tot de volledige capaciteit van elk stans geheugen
  • Bescherming tegen stroomuitval
  • API levert benodigde tools om flash geheugen aan te passen aan de snelheid die ontwikkelaars nodig hebben
  • Schudt het oude HDD-paradigma door elkaar
  • Enkele IO- of meerdere IO-modi aanpassen
  • Werklastisolatie op stansniveau waarmee ook meerdere IO-modi tegelijkertijd kunnen worden uitgevoerd
  • Maximaliseert flexibiliteit, schaalbaarheid, prestaties, parallellisme en snelheid van flash geheugen

Open Source API en bibliotheken versnellen en vereenvoudigen innovatie in Hyperscale Storage

  • Komt de belofte na van opslag die is ontwikkeld met de snelheid van software
  • De API biedt Hyperscale-ontwikkelaars tools en vrijheid om te innoveren en aan te passen aan hun behoeften.
  • Versnel de ontwikkelingstijd van het flash geheugen om een concurrentievoordeel te creëren
  • Vrij te gebruiken, aan te passen en te ontwikkelen voor flashopslagvereisten
  • Flash-native API legt alle tools in handen van opslagontwikkelaars

Speciaal gebouwde hardware

  • Abstracten flash geheugentype, generatiewijzigingen en leveranciersverschillen
  • Levert hostbesturing en CPU-offloadfuncties
  • Ontworpen voor flexibele DRAM-configuraties
  • Verlengt de gezondheid, de levensduur en het prestatievermogen van het flash geheugen

Documenten en video's

Documenten